Abstract: To stop the transmission of COVID-19, strategies such as quarantine and social distancing were used, leading to the closure of establishments, schools and businesses and affecting society at different levels. For children, the impacts of these measures were felt, among other areas, in the family context and in school life. It is projected that the closure of schools, period of social isolation and the pandemic context will cause harm to children, since emotional, physical and cognitive impacts may have been generated during this period. The present study aimed to analyze the neuropsychological functions of children from a public school in the Distrito Federal (Brazil), enrolled in the 1st and 2nd year of Class Elementary School at the time of reopening of public schools in the COVID-19 pandemic and the influence of family and contextual factors on the performance of these skills. 118 students from the 1st and 2nd year of Regular Class Elementary School participated voluntarily, as well as their parents or guardians. To evaluate the children, the Brief Child Neuropsychological Assessment Instrument (NEUPSILIN INF) was applied in person, after the easing of social isolation. Furthermore, the parents/guardians answered the Inventory of Resources of the Family Environment (RAF) and questions for socioeconomic classification and maternal schooling, remotely. The results suggest a high prevalence of children in the literacy phase who present alert or deficits in orientation, memory, language, visuospatial skills, arithmetic skills and verbal fluency. Furthermore, activities that reflect the degree of stability are predictors of children's performance in orientation skills and resources that promote proximal processes significantly reflect on language performance. The results show that children included in families with estimates of household income below one minimum wage present worse performance in inhibitory control. In this work, we evidenced the possible impacts of changes in neuropsychological skills for the learning of these children, and how contextual factors influenced the performance of some of these functions.
